About Colleen A Redding, PhD

Colleen A Redding, PhD, With an exceptional h-index of 54 and a recent h-index of 29 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at University of Rhode Island, specializes in the field of Health Behavior Change, Tailored Interventions, Population Health Promotion, HIV Prevention, Transtheoretical Model.
